Baseball Recap: Springstead Eagles vs. River Ridge Royal Knights

After flying high against Central last Tuesday, Springstead came back down to earth. The Springstead Eagles lost 8-1 to the River Ridge Royal Knights on Thursday. The game marked the Eagles' lowest-scoring contest so far this season.

Springstead got a good showing from Himanchall Persaud, who tossed three innings while giving up no earned runs off six hits.

On the hitting side, Springstead sa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Billy Ward, who went 1-for-2 with one RBI.

Springstead moved to 5-2 with that defeat, which also ended their four-game winning streak. They've dominated over that stretch too, winning by an average of 8.8 runs. As for River Ridge, the win snapped their losing streak at three games and leaves them with a 3-3 record.

Coming up, Springstead will challenge Central at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Central's pitching crew has only allowed 3.8 runs per game this season, so Springstead's hitters will have their work cut out for them. As for River Ridge, they will face off against Hudson at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
